Good compression for a 10.5 hp Briggs and Stratton engine typically falls within the range of 90 to 120 psi. Compression values can vary based on the engine's condition and age, but readings below 90 psi may indicate potential issues such as worn piston rings or valves. It's important to ensure that the engine is at operating temperature and that the spark plug is removed when measuring compression for accurate results. Regular maintenance can help maintain optimal compression levels.
To repair a Briggs & Stratton 4.5 hp engine with low compression, first, perform a compression test to confirm the issue. If compression is low, check for potential causes such as worn piston rings, a damaged cylinder, or a blown head gasket. You can remove the cylinder head to inspect these components, replacing any damaged parts. Reassemble the engine, ensuring all gaskets are properly sealed, and retest the compression to verify the repair.
In a two-stroke engine, the compression ratio typically ranges from about 6:1 to 12:1, depending on the specific design and application. Higher performance two-stroke engines, such as those used in racing or high-performance applications, may achieve even higher compression ratios. The optimal compression ratio helps to maximize power output and efficiency while minimizing emissions. However, it’s crucial to balance compression with fuel quality to prevent knocking or detonation.

There is no separate compression stroke on a 2 stroke engine, but there is compression - the intake and compression take place on the same staroke, the intake on the first part and compression on the later part.
